SQL Server 2008安全机制解析
"SQLServer2008的安全机制主要包括身份验证模式和主体的管理,以及权限的控制。" 在Microsoft SQL Server 2008中,安全机制是保障数据库系统核心功能的重要组成部分,确保只有授权的合法用户能访问系统并执行相应操作。安全机制主要涉及以下几个方面: 1. **身份验证模式**: - **Windows身份验证模式**:在这种模式下,SQL Server使用Windows操作系统提供的身份验证服务。用户需提供Windows账户名和密码,由Windows验证用户身份,然后允许访问SQL Server。 - **混合模式**:混合模式允许用户选择使用Windows身份验证或SQL Server自身的身份验证。这使得那些无法直接使用Windows账户访问SQL Server的用户(如远程用户)仍能通过SQL Server登录名和密码进行身份验证。 2. **主体**: - **主体**是SQL Server中代表可以请求系统资源的实体,如数据库用户、登录名、角色等。主体分为多个层次,包括Windows级(如Windows用户、组)、SQL Server级(如SQL Server登录名、固定服务器角色)和数据库级(如数据库用户、固定数据库角色、应用程序角色)。 - 主体间的权限分配是层次化的,高层次主体具有更广泛的系统影响力,而低层次主体则局限于特定的数据库或对象。 3. **权限管理**: - 解决用户登录后可执行的操作和使用的对象问题,SQL Server通过安全对象和权限设置实现。安全对象包括服务器安全对象和数据库安全对象,它们定义了权限的范围。 - 用户的权限根据其所属的角色进行分配,如固定服务器角色和固定数据库角色。这些角色预设了一组权限,简化了权限管理。 - 应用程序角色是为特定的应用程序设计的,它提供了一种在多用户环境中限制应用程序访问数据库资源的方式。 SQL Server 2008的安全机制旨在平衡系统的开放性和安全性,确保数据的隐私和系统的稳定性。通过精细的身份验证和权限控制,管理员可以精确地定义每个用户的访问权限,从而有效地防止未经授权的访问和潜在的数据泄露风险。同时,这种机制也支持企业级的数据管理和合规性要求,为企业数据环境提供了坚实的保护。
剩余41页未读,继续阅读
- 粉丝: 745
- 资源: 7万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 多模态联合稀疏表示在视频目标跟踪中的应用
- Kubernetes资源管控与Gardener开源软件实践解析
- MPI集群监控与负载平衡策略
- 自动化PHP安全漏洞检测:静态代码分析与数据流方法
- 青苔数据CEO程永:技术生态与阿里云开放创新
- 制造业转型: HyperX引领企业上云策略
- 赵维五分享:航空工业电子采购上云实战与运维策略
- 单片机控制的LED点阵显示屏设计及其实现
- 驻云科技李俊涛:AI驱动的云上服务新趋势与挑战
- 6LoWPAN物联网边界路由器:设计与实现
- 猩便利工程师仲小玉:Terraform云资源管理最佳实践与团队协作
- 类差分度改进的互信息特征选择提升文本分类性能
- VERITAS与阿里云合作的混合云转型与数据保护方案
- 云制造中的生产线仿真模型设计与虚拟化研究
- 汪洋在PostgresChina2018分享:高可用 PostgreSQL 工具与架构设计
- 2018 PostgresChina大会:阿里云时空引擎Ganos在PostgreSQL中的创新应用与多模型存储